II.1.1) Title
Provision of Rating Consultants for 2023 Non-Domestic Rating Revaluation
Reference number: NMD-OJEU-49700
II.1.2) Main CPV code
70000000
II.1.3) Type of contract
Services
II.1.4) Short description
NWSSP on behalf of all NHS organisations in Wales seeks to establish a contract for Professional Services (in the case of Lots 1&2
Chartered Surveyor professional services) to support the 2023 Non-domestic Rating Revaluation. A consultant is required to establish full
rating assessment details for each Health Board and/or Trust property and undertake a rating survey of each site and manage the whole
appeals process on behalf of these organisations.
